Tradition, Countryside and Contemporary ease

London

Royal heritage & dynamic culture

Vintage markets in the East and world-class museums and theatres in the west, hidden Georgian squares, and diverse neighborhoods where history lives alongside innovation in food, art and culture.

The Cotswolds

Village charm

Honey-stone cottages, rolling hills, afternoon tea, antique markets, and walking paths through countryside where time moves deliberately slow. Wellies and wellness.

Yorkshire

Moors & coast

Big-sky, rolling moors, dramatic limestone valleys, windswept coastlines and villages that feel unchanged because they never need improving.

The Lake District

Mountain lakes

The landscape that shaped Wordsworth, all-day hiking around sixteen serene lakes, never far from shelter or food in beautiful stone villages, England's outdoor soul.

Edinburgh

The Edinburgh Castle

The Edinburgh Castle defines the skyline, with the Royal Mile stretching out below. It's a cosmopolitan city that offers all of the sophistication and culture that any traveler would desire, yet it still retains its ancient, gritty charm. Edinburgh's distinctive architecture offers a glimpse into the world of Harry Potter.

Scotland

Highlands & Islands

Edinburgh festivals and layers of history, dramatic landscapes of rugged islands, ancient castles and dramatic Highlands, single-malt whisky, and Highland hospitality warmed by peat fires.
